页面活动的处理方法及装置的制造方法
[0080]进一步地,还可以进一步根据悬浮组件所在指定区域(例如,页面右上角)所展现的展现内容,设置悬浮组件的透明度参数。
[0081]具体地,具体可以开启一个计时器任务,以实现每500毫秒(ms)检测所述指定区域所展现的展现内容。
[0082]若所述指定区域所展现的展现内容为空白界面,则将浮窗组件的透明度参数设置为0,以实现非透明展现浮窗组件。
[0083]若所述指定区域所展现的展现内容不为空白界面,则将浮窗组件的透明度参数设置为大于0且小于1的数值,例如,0.5或0.9等数值,以实现半透明展现浮窗组件。
[0084]进一步地,还可以进一步检测所在终端是否显示浮窗组件。如果浮窗组件由于异常原因消失即终端没有显示浮窗组件,具体可以再通过安卓操作系统提供的WindowManager类的addView(View v)方法,进行浮窗组件的重新添加。
[0085]这样,通过在页面活动当前所在页面上,利用悬浮组件,以多媒体方式,输出该页面上的页面活动所对应的操作指导信息,使得能够在不影响当前所展现的页面的布局的情况下,展现附加的其它内容,从而提高了页面展现的一致性。
[0086]本实施例中,通过获取用户在页面上所操作的页面活动,进而,根据所述页面活动,获得操作指导信息,使得能够基于所述页面活动,输出所述操作指导信息,以供所述用户根据所述操作指导信息,操作所述页面活动,由于能够基于当前页面,输出操作指导信息,使得能够避免现有技术中由于用户通过当前应用在页面上操作页面活动时还需要再通过当前应用或其他应用浏览其他页面或执行其他操作而导致的增加应用与其所使用的处理引擎之间的数据交互的问题,从而降低了处理引擎的处理负担。
[0087]另外,采用本发明所提供的技术方案,通过提供提交页面活动相关的候选操作信息的入口,进而获取其他用户根据操作页面活动,以多媒体方式,所提供的至少两个候选操作信息,使得能够根据所述至少两个候选操作信息,选择一个候选操作信息,作为所述操作指导信息,能够吸引更多的用户参与加入到页面活动的指导操作中,能够有效调动用户积极性,增强用户粘性。
[0088]另外,采用本发明所提供的技术方案,通过在页面活动当前所在页面上,利用悬浮组件,以多媒体方式,输出该页面上的页面活动所对应的操作指导信息,使得能够在不影响当前所展现的页面的布局的情况下,展现附加的其它内容,从而提高了页面展现的一致性。
[0089]需要说明的是,对于前述的各方法实施例,为了简单描述,故将其都表述为一系列的动作组合,但是本领域技术人员应该知悉,本发明并不受所描述的动作顺序的限制,因为依据本发明,某些步骤可以采用其他顺序或者同时进行。其次,本领域技术人员也应该知悉,说明书中所描述的实施例均属于优选实施例,所涉及的动作和模块并不一定是本发明所必须的。
[0090]在上述实施例中,对各个实施例的描述都各有侧重,某个实施例中没有详述的部分,可以参见其他实施例的相关描述。
[0091]图2为本发明另一实施例提供的页面活动的处理装置的结构示意图,如图2所示。本实施例的页面活动的处理装置可以包括获取单元21、匹配单元22和输出单元23。其中,获取单元21,用于获取用户在页面上所操作的页面活动;匹配单元22,用于根据所述页面活动,获得操作指导信息;输出单元23,用于基于所述页面活动,输出所述操作指导信息,以供所述用户根据所述操作指导信息,操作所述页面活动。
[0092]需要说明的是,本实施例的页面活动的处理装置的部分或全部可以为位于本地终端的应用,或者还可以为设置在位于本地终端的应用中的插件或软件开发工具包(Software Development Kit,SDK)等功能单元,或者还可以为位于网格侧服务器中的处理引擎,或者还可以为位于网格侧的分布式系统,本实施例对此不进行特别限定。
[0093]可以理解的是,所述应用可以是安装在终端上的本地程序(nativeApp),或者还可以是终端上的浏览器的一个网页程序(webApp),本实施例对此不进行特别限定。
[0094]所谓的页面活动,是指用户基于页面所进行的一系列娱乐性活动,可以包括但不限于下列项目中的至少一项:游戏活动、抽奖活动、抢购活动、商品打折活动、做任务活动以及答题活动。
[0095]可选地,在本实施例的一个可能的实现方式中,所述匹配单元22,还可以进一步用于获取所述操作指导信息,所述操作指导信息为其他用户根据操作所述页面活动,以多媒体方式,所提供的;以及根据所述操作指导信息,建立所述页面活动与所述操作指导信息之间的对应关系,以供根据所述页面活动,获得所述页面活动所对应的操作指导信息。
[0096]其中,所述多媒体方式可以包括但不限于下列传播方式中的至少一项:文字方式、图像方式、音频方式、视频方式以及动画方式。
[0097]在一个具体的实现过程中,所述匹配单元22,具体可以用于若获取其他用户根据操作所述页面活动,以所述多媒体方式,所提供的一个候选操作信息,那么,则可以直接将该候选操作信息,作为所述操作指导信息。
[0098]在另一个具体的实现过程中,所述匹配单元22,具体可以用于若获取至少两个候选操作信息,所述至少两个候选操作信息为其他用户根据操作所述页面活动,以所述多媒体方式,所提供的,那么,则可以根据所述至少两个候选操作信息,选择一个候选操作信息,作为所述操作指导信息。
[0099]可选地,在本实施例的一个可能的实现方式中,所述匹配单元22,还可以进一步用于获取所述操作指导信息,所述操作指导信息为所述页面活动的提供方,以多媒体方式,所提供的;以及根据所述操作指导信息,建立所述页面活动与所述操作指导信息之间的对应关系,以供根据所述页面活动,获得所述页面活动所对应的操作指导信息。
[0100]可选地,在本实施例的一个可能的实现方式中,所述输出单元23,具体可以用于基于所述页面活动,以多媒体方式,输出所述操作指导信息。
[0101]具体地,输出单元23,具体可以用于在所述页面活动所在的页面上,利用悬浮组件,以多媒体方式,输出所述操作指导信息。
[0102]其中,所述多媒体方式可以包括但不限于下列传播方式中的至少一项:文字方式、图像方式、音频方式、视频方式以及动画方式。
[0103]需要说明的是,图1对应的实施例中方法,可以由本实施例提供的页面活动的处理装置实现。详细描述可以参见图1对应的实施例中的相关内容,此处不再赘述。
[0104]本实施例中,通过获取单元获取用户在页面上所操作的页面活动,进而,由匹配单元根据所述页面活动,获得操作指导信息,使得输出单元能够基于所述页面活动,输出所述操作指导信息,以供所述用户根据所述操作指导信息,操作所述页面活动,由于能够基于当前页面,输出操作指导信息,使得能够避免现有技术中由于用户通过当前应用在页面上操作页面活动时还需要再通过当前应用或其他应用浏览其他页面或执行其他操作而导致的增加应用与其所使用的处理引擎之间的数据交互的问题,从而降低了处理引擎的处理负担。
[0105]另外,采用本发明所提供的技术方案,通过提供提交页面活动相关的候选操作信息的入口,进而获取其他用户根据操作页面活动,以多媒体方式,所提供的至少两个候选操作信息,使得能够根据所述至少两个候选操作信息,选择一个候选操作信息,作为所述操作指导信息,能够吸引更多的用户参与加入到页面活动的指导操作中,能够有效调动用户积极性,增强用户粘性。
[0106]另外,采用本发明所提供的技术方案,通过在页面活动当前所在页面上,利用悬浮组件,以多媒体方式,输出该页面上的页面活动所对
文档序号 :
【 9646378 】
技术研发人员:廉晓洋,孟杰
技术所有人:百度在线网络技术(北京)有限公司
备 注:该技术已申请专利,仅供学习研究,如用于商业用途,请联系技术所有人。
声 明 :此信息收集于网络,如果你是此专利的发明人不想本网站收录此信息请联系我们,我们会在第一时间删除
技术研发人员:廉晓洋,孟杰
技术所有人:百度在线网络技术(北京)有限公司
备 注:该技术已申请专利,仅供学习研究,如用于商业用途,请联系技术所有人。
声 明 :此信息收集于网络,如果你是此专利的发明人不想本网站收录此信息请联系我们,我们会在第一时间删除